Former IAS officer Kannan Gopinathan on Monday (October 13, 2025) joined Congress in the presence of Congress General Secretary K.C. Venugopal and party leader Pawan Khera in New Delhi.

Mr. Gopinathan, who had been serving as the secretary of the power, urban development and town and country planning departments of the Union Territory of Dadra and Nagar Haveli, resigned in 2019, protesting against the abrogation of Article 370 in Jammu and Kashmir.

“We warmly welcome Shri Kannan Gopinathan, former IAS officer and fearless voice for democracy, to the Congress family, Mr. Venugopal posted on X, sharing the photo of the press meet in which Mr. Gopinathan was invited to the party.

Gujarat MLA Jignesh Mevani and Congress leader Kanhaiya Kumar were also present in the press meet.
